How they compare

Suriname currently reports 88,667 constant LCU per square kilometre against 59,162 constant LCU per square kilometre in Eritrea, a difference of 29,505 constant LCU per square kilometre.

That makes Suriname's figure about 1.5 times Eritrea's.

The two have swapped places 2 times across 17 shared years of data; in 1993 it was Suriname ahead.

Eritrea ranks 190th and Suriname ranks 188th of 195 countries.

Suriname has averaged higher in every one of the 2 decades both report.
